Mount Vesuvius: A Descriptive, Historical, and Geological Account of the Volcano and its Surroundings offers a clear, accessible look at one of the world’s most famous mountains.

It blends descriptive detail with historical context and scientific explanation to help readers understand Vesuvius from multiple angles. This edition gathers current observations and scholarly insights to present the volcano’s story in a connected, readable form. It covers its history, geology, eruptions, and surrounding landscape, making it suitable for curious visitors, students, and readers of natural history alike.

  • Foundational history of Vesuvian activity and notable eruptions
  • Geology of the cone, base, and surrounding features
  • Descriptions of volcanic products, minerals, and flora related to the region
  • Discussion of theories on volcanic action and seismology linked to Vesuvian phenomena
